Official: Blind signs with Bayern

FC Bayern München made the signing of Dutch veteran Daley Blind official late Thursday evening.

Ninety-nine-times-capped Dutch international Daley Blind will soon get the chance to play alongside countryman Matthijs de Ligt for the German record champions. League-leaders FC Bayern München made the high-profile signing initially reported upon early in the day official lat Thursday evening.


The 32-year-old joins the FCB on a free following the dissolution of his contract with Ajax Amsterdam. As reported by German media sources earlier in the day, Blind only signed a short-term contract good through the end of the current season.

"Daley is a flexible defender, he can play on the left side as well as inside," FCB sporting director Hasan Salihamidzic noted in a statement accompanying the signing published on the club's website, He has great international experience and leadership qualities. I am sure he will help us."

"I can hardly wait to play here," Blind himself added, " We're now entering the most important part of the season, where the titles are at stake - and a club like FC Bayern can win any trophy. The hunger for titles here at the club was crucial to my decision. I hope I can use my experience to help the team and will give everything for Bayern Munich."
